ABAQUS是一款广泛应用于工程领域的大型有限元分析软件,它可以帮助工程师和研究人员模拟和分析复杂的力学问题。对于初学者来说,掌握ABAQUS的基本命令和实用技巧是非常重要的。本文将详细讲解ABAQUS的框架命令及其应用,帮助您快速入门。
一、ABAQUS软件概述
ABAQUS软件由美国SIMULIA公司开发,是目前最流行的有限元分析软件之一。它广泛应用于汽车、航空航天、建筑、土木工程、生物医学等领域。ABAQUS软件具有以下特点:
- 强大的前处理和后处理功能
- 高度灵活的求解器
- 广泛的有限元分析功能
- 强大的用户自定义功能
二、ABAQUS框架命令详解
ABAQUS的框架命令是指用户在输入文件中编写的用于控制分析过程和设置分析参数的语句。以下是一些常用的框架命令:
1. />Title 命令
用于设置分析标题,格式如下:
/TITLE, Title of the analysis
例如:
/TITLE, Structural Analysis of a Beam
2. /PREP7 子程序
用于建立几何模型、材料属性、边界条件和载荷等,是ABAQUS分析的前处理部分。以下是几个常用的/PREP7命令:
- /MODEL:创建一个新的模型。
/MODEL, mymodel
- /PREP7:进入前处理子程序。
/PREP7
- /MAT:定义材料属性。
/MAT, ELASTIC, LINEAR
/E, EX, 200e3
/E, EY, 200e3
/G, POISSON, 0.3
- /ATT:定义截面属性。
/ATT, 1, PLANE_STRAIN
- /BOUND:定义边界条件。
/BOUND, 1, U, 0, ALL
- /FILL:定义填充区域。
/FILL, 1, 2, 3
3. /SOLU 子程序
用于设置求解参数和分析类型,是ABAQUS分析的求解部分。以下是几个常用的/SOLU命令:
- /SOLU:进入求解子程序。
/SOLU
- /SOLVE:执行求解。
/SOLVE
- /FREQ:设置频率分析参数。
/FREQ, 1, 100, 10
- /STAB:设置稳定性参数。
/STAB, 1, 0.01
4. /POST1 子程序
用于查看和分析分析结果,是ABAQUS分析的后处理部分。以下是几个常用的/POST1命令:
- /POST1:进入后处理子程序。
/POST1
- /ESOLVE:显示解。
/ESOLVE
- /PLNSOL:显示等值线。
/PLNSOL, S
三、ABAQUS实用技巧
使用模板文件:在ABAQUS中,可以创建模板文件,将常用的命令和参数保存下来,方便以后重复使用。
利用帮助文档:ABAQUS提供了丰富的帮助文档,可以查阅各个命令的详细说明和示例。
练习编程:ABAQUS支持Python编程,可以通过编写Python脚本来自动化分析过程。
参加培训课程:参加ABAQUS培训课程,可以帮助您快速掌握ABAQUS的基本知识和技能。
总之,掌握ABAQUS的框架命令和实用技巧对于学习和应用ABAQUS软件至关重要。通过本文的讲解,相信您已经对ABAQUS有了初步的了解。祝您在ABAQUS的学习和应用中取得成功!
